I would recommend against bike specific.
The only difference is they are pre-drilled, but they are pre-drilled for the stock pipes, so if you have lower aftermarket pipes, getting the non-specific model will allow you to mount the bags lower, which looks a lot better.
Bike specific tends to put the lids up near the top of the pillion.
I did have to get creative with spacers and hardware to clear my caliper.
Plan on investing in an assortment of 8mm bolts of various lengths.
